What a picture, mirror, curtain & shelf hanging job includes

Hanging work — pictures, mirrors, curtain poles, blinds and shelves — is charged at the handyman hourly rate of £35 with a one-hour minimum and then in 30-minute blocks, because a single mirror and a whole hallway of frames are not the same job. Most of the skill is before the drill goes anywhere near the wall: working out what the wall is made of, what is buried in it, and what the fixing will actually hold once the item is loaded.

Before anything is drilled

  • Wall build-up identified — solid brick, block, dot-and-dab, plasterboard on studs, or lath and plaster
  • Cable and pipe detection across the full drilling zone, not just the marked point
  • Weight of the item checked against the fixing and the wall, and a load judgement given before work starts
  • Positions marked, levelled and shown to you for sign-off while they can still be moved

Fixing

  • Anchor matched to the wall type — plasterboard toggles or metal anchors where there is no timber, frame fixings into masonry
  • Studs and noggins located and used where the load justifies it
  • Curtain poles and tracks bracketed at the right centres so long spans do not sag
  • Blinds fitted face or top fix depending on the recess, with the drop checked before final tightening
  • Shelves levelled along their length and squared to the wall rather than to the skirting
  • Mirrors and heavy frames fitted on their manufacturer's hardware, or on a cleat where the supplied hooks are not adequate

Finishing

  • Every item loaded and tested before we leave — poles hung with the curtains on, shelves weighted
  • Dust caught at the hole rather than swept up afterwards
  • Spare fixings bagged and left with you
  • Anything we judged unsafe to fit explained, with the alternative we would use

What changes the price on a picture, mirror, curtain & shelf hanging job

  • Bay windows, deep recesses and out-of-square reveals make pole and blind work longer than a straight run of the same width. Tell us the shape of the window when you book and the estimate will be right.
  • Several small items in one visit is the cheapest way to buy this work, because the setup, scanning and clean-up happen once. If the list is long enough, a half day or full day is usually better value and we will point that out.
  • Wall type decides everything. Plasterboard with nothing behind it will not carry a heavy mirror on ordinary plugs; if the wall will not hold what you want on it, we say so and offer the fixing that will, rather than hanging it and hoping.
  • Lath and plaster in older properties crumbles if it is drilled fast and dry. It takes longer and occasionally needs the fixing moved a few centimetres to catch a lath — that is normal, not a problem with the wall.
  • Cables and pipes run in predictable zones, but extensions and rewires often ignore them. We scan first every time, and where a detector is ambiguous we move the fixing rather than take the risk.

  • Can you hang a heavy mirror on a plasterboard wall?

    Usually yes, with the right anchor — a metal toggle or a fixing into the stud behind. We check the wall build-up and the weight of the mirror first and tell you what we would use. If the wall genuinely will not carry it, we say so rather than fitting it and leaving you with the risk.

  • How do you avoid drilling into a cable or a pipe?

    Every drilling position is scanned before work starts, across the whole zone rather than the single marked point. Where the reading is unclear we move the fixing. In kitchens and bathrooms, where services are densest, we plan the positions around the likely runs from the outset.

  • Will you put the curtains and blinds up as well as the brackets?

    Yes. The job is not finished until the pole is loaded, the curtains are drawn and the blind is raised and lowered through its full travel. That is when a sagging span or a fouling bracket shows up, and we would rather find it while we are still there.

  • Can you take down what is already on the wall?

    Yes — old brackets, poles and shelves come down as part of the visit, and the holes left behind are filled if you would like them filled. Making good with paint is not part of this service.

  • How long does a set of pictures take?

    A single picture on a straightforward wall is inside the one-hour minimum. A gallery wall of eight to twelve frames typically takes two to three hours, because the layout is set out and levelled as a group before anything is fixed.
